Doable : the girls' guide to accomplishing just about anything / Deborah Reber.

Do-able : (other title)
Reber, Deborah, (author.).

Summary:

"Got goals? This empowering guide shows how to tackle your to-dos with confidence and enthusiasm so that you can transform anxiety into accomplishment."--Provided by publisher.

Content descriptions

Formatted Contents Note:
The doable way -- Step 1: define your to do -- Step 2: detail the little tasks -- Step 3: defend against obstacles -- Step 4: develop support systems -- Step 5: determine what success looks like -- Step 6: do the work -- Step 7: deal with setbacks -- Step 8: deliver the goods -- How doable became doable.
